1. Importance of Proper Diagnosis

  Diagnosing the need for a root canal is the foundational step in ensuring effective treatment. Dental practitioners must rely on comprehensive clinical examinations and diagnostic imaging, such as X-rays, to confirm the extent of pulp damage or infection. Misdiagnosis can lead to unnecessary treatments or failure to treat the actual cause of discomfort.

  Moreover, it is essential to distinguish between reversible and irreversible pulpitis. A thorough understanding of the symptoms presented by the patient, along with clinical tests like percussion and palpation, helps in making an accurate diagnosis. This precise approach sets the stage for an effective treatment plan.

  In addition to clinical exams, dental history plays a crucial role. Understanding the patient’s past dental issues, pain levels, and responses to treatments can provide insight into their current condition. Overall, investing time in achieving an accurate diagnosis can significantly influence the outcome of the root canal treatment.

  

2. Selecting the Right Tools and Materials

  The success of a root canal procedure largely depends on the tools and materials used during the treatment. High-quality endodontic instruments, such as nickel-titanium files, offer flexibility and strength, enabling thorough cleaning and shaping of the root canal system. The selection of appropriate files is crucial, as it affects the efficiency and safety of the treatment.

  Moreover, utilizing advanced irrigation solutions is essential to eliminate debris and bacteria from the canals. Sodium hypochlorite and EDTA are commonly used because they aid in dissolving organic material and enhancing disinfection. The proper selection and application of these materials are vital for ensuring the complete cleaning of the root canal space.

  Finally, the use of biocompatible filling materials, like gutta-percha, ensures a reliable seal in the root canal. Adequate sealing is essential to prevent future infections and reinfection of the treated tooth. Therefore, investing in quality tools and materials contributes to the overall efficacy and safety of root canal treatment.

  

3. Ensuring Patient Comfort and Anxiety Management

  Addressing patient comfort and managing anxiety are paramount components of root canal treatment. Many patients associate dental procedures with pain and discomfort, leading to apprehension. Establishing a calming environment and providing effective pain management strategies, including local anesthesia, can significantly enhance the patient experience.

  Additionally, communication plays a vital role in alleviating anxiety. Dentists should explain the procedure clearly and answer any questions the patient may have. Informing patients about what to expect can demystify the process, reducing fears associated with the treatment.

  Implementing techniques like sedation dentistry may also be beneficial for patients with severe anxiety. Options such as nitrous oxide or oral sedatives can help patients feel relaxed and more at ease during the procedure, ultimately leading to a smoother treatment experience.

  

4. Post-operative Care for Optimal Healing

  Post-operative care is critical in promoting healing and ensuring the long-term success of a root canal treatment. After the procedure, patients should receive clear instructions regarding pain management, potential side effects, and signs of complications. This guidance is essential in helping patients navigate their recovery without undue stress.

  Furthermore, dental professionals should schedule follow-up appointments to monitor the healing process. Regular check-ups allow practitioners to address any concerns and manage potential complications promptly. These visits also reinforce the importance of good oral hygiene practices to maintain the health of the treated tooth.

  Finally, encouraging patients to report any unusual symptoms, such as persistent pain or swelling, fosters open communication and boosts confidence in the care they are receiving. This proactive approach enhances overall patient satisfaction and contributes to the long-term success of the treatment.
